Senior Finance Manager
FNZ (Europe) DAC is a member company of the FNZ Group. The FNZ Group ambition in Ireland and in Europe is to continue our growth by continuing to offer excellent service to our existing clients, by acquiring new clients and by extending the range of services on offer.
FNZ is a global platform provider in the wealth management sector, partnering with over 650 of the world’s leading financial institutions and over 8,000 wealth management firms. With over 5,000 employees in 24 countries, FNZ’s mission is to open-up wealth, empowering all people to create wealth through personal investment, aligned with things they care about the most, on their own terms.
FNZ combines technology, infrastructure and investment operations in a single state-of-the-art platform that frees its institutional customers to create hyper-personalized and innovative products and services, that are seamlessly aligned with the needs of their clients. To date, FNZ has enabled over 20 million people, from all wealth segments, to invest in an effective, simple and transparent way, making wealth management accessible to everyone.

Responsibilities:

Reporting directly to the EU CFO based in Dublin, the Senior Finance Manager will be part of the EU Finance team and will play a lead role in the oversight of key of monthly, quarterly and annual financial reporting processes as well as the management of business critical day-to-day tasks and the annual audit of the consolidated EU entity.
Managing a small team, the role will have a strong business facing presence, both with key stakeholders within the EU entity and also with the FNZ group finance team, interacting with teams across a broad spectrum, including commercial, sales, tax, treasury and AP.

Some of the key tasks which the Finance Manager will oversee include:

  • Monthly accounts process, including all revenue & cost postings and associated performance reporting including variance & KPI analysis
  • Central Bank reporting
  • Preparation of annual statutory accounts (prepared under IFRS) and management of the annual audit process
  • EU Finance lead on treasury, payroll, VAT and other tax processes, liaising with group finance colleagues to prepare timely and accurate returns and reports
  • Overall oversight of the EU ledger, including review of journal postings, reconciliations and consolidation for management accounting purposes
  • Work closely with the EU and Group FP&A teams to provide ongoing review of budget v actual performance and refresh of the forecast of the EU entity
  • Ensuring that the finance risk & control environment is managed appropriately

FNZ (Europe) DAC is a dynamic, fast paced and geographically diverse entity. The Senior Finance Manager will be at the forefront of managing the EU Finance function’s relationships with our colleagues all across Europe and the ability to communicate, partner the business and cultivate relationships within the EU entity and wider FNZ business globally will be a key component of the role.
